finished my shocks. Billstein Off road shocks for lifted truck. ALso put on new sway bar end links from Maxx suspension.

Now I don't want to sell my truck! it only has 85K miles on it now I know I can get much more out of it.

Just need to get the brakes dialed in. Gonna do the proportioning valve trick/bleed the system.

I've had an interesting past few months with the truck. A lot of driving and hauling with a trailer. After hauling with the trailer some issues popped up. Drivers inside pad decided to explode, so I got new rotors, pads and calipers and put those in. Checked everything over, looked good, more driving for another week then I'm being followed by 100 horses! Click clack click clack lol, drivers side axle shaft u-joint is on it's way out, real quick. Start ripping it apart again and the hub assembly and bearing are shot, great. Put more new parts up front. Another week of driving and get off work a little early, start to drive home, just get into the 100KM zone, BAM, hit a freaking deer! Now I'm on the search for a new bumper, grille and passenger side headlight and marker. All of which new, are in the price of gold range. I think my luck with this truck has run out and time to find 3/4 or 1 ton for a toy hauler.
